Okay, this is everything I know about texture manipulation with Wintex 4.2.

ADDING NEW TEXTURES: Click on the wad you want to add tex's to or make a new wad. A new window pops up listing all entries of any kind in the selected wad. At the top of the window click on ADVANCED.

From the drop down window select Edit Textures, which will pop up another new window.

On the left side of the screen are all the textures currently in that wad, if the wad didn't have any new textures in it, the list is the one from the main DOOM/DOOM2 IWAD.

On the right side of the screen is a list of all the patches in the wad your editing AND all the ones in the main IWAD. You use these to make your texture.

In the center is the list of patches in the texture selected from the list on the left. The buttons are all for moving the patches position on the texture surface.

CHANGING SWITCH TEXTURES: is more tricky. This is for plain DOOMs, not source ports.

If you want to take patches out of SW1BLUE for example, you can't just delete the patch. You have to select the switch TEXTURE in the left hand list, then go to the top of the page and hit TEXTURES and select CUT TEXTURE from the menu.

Now the whole texture has been deleted. Now hit TEXTURES at the top of the page again and select NEW TEXTURE. Type in the exact name of the switch tex and it will be added to the list of textures. Now just change the size of the tex and add patches for your desired result.

No, you can't just paste the texture back in, you have to cut it out and add it back in as a new texture. I don't know why it works, just that it does.
